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i...

36
08 Eyl. 2016 Öğr. Gör. Murat KEÇECĠOĞLU Elbistan Meslek Yüksek Okulu 2016 – 2017 Güz Yarıyılı Ders Tanıtım Sunumu Database Managegement II

Transcript of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i...

Page 1: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

08 Eyl. 2016

Öğr. Gör. Murat KEÇECĠOĞLUElbistan Meslek Yüksek Okulu2016 – 2017 Güz Yarıyılı

Ders Tanıtım Sunumu

Database Managegement II

Page 2: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

KURULUM

Page 3: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

SQL SERVER

2016 yılı başlarında piyasaya çıkan SQL Server 2016 ürününün beta versiyonunun kurulumunu yapacağız.

SQL Server 2016 şu anda piyasaya çıkmamış olmakla birlikte aşağıdaki özellikleri taşıyacağı belirtilmektedir.

Page 4: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

SQL SERVER

SQL Server 2016 önceki sürümlerinin üzerine geliştirilen güvenlik, performans, farklı ortamlarla etkileşim noktasında şüphesiz birçok yenilikle karşımıza geliyor.

Genel olarak yeni çıkan ürünler alt sürüm ürünlerin yapabildiklerini yapmakla birlikte ek olarak yeni kabiliyetlerle gelirler.

Page 5: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

SQL SERVER

Öncelikle kurulum gereksinimlerine bakalım.

Üstteki link üzerinden detaylı olarak kurulum için gerekli olan donanımsal veya yazılımsal gereksinimlere göz atabilirsiniz.

https://msdn.microsoft.com/en-us/library/ms143506.aspx

Page 6: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

E-postaGSM no

https://www.microsoft.com/en-us/evalcenter/evaluate-sql-server-2016

Buradan gerekli ISO dosyasını indirebilirsiniz.

Page 7: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

Setup dosyası çalıştırılır.

MsSQL 2016 Beta Kurulumu

Page 8: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

Güvenlik denetimi bu kurulumun mevcut platformdaçalışmasına izin vermeniz anlamına gelir.

MsSQL 2016 Beta Kurulumu

Page 9: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Page 10: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

MsSql kurulum sırasında gelen bu ekran ile;

1- Yeni bir kurulum, 2- Var olan kurulum üzerinde özellik ekleme, çıkartma, 3- Cluster kurulumu, 4- Clustere node ekleme, eski versiyondan yeni versiyona upgrade

gibi işlemler yapılabilir.

Page 11: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Yeni bir kurulum yapacağımız için Installation tabında yer alan “New SQL Server stand-alone installation oradd features to an existing installation” seçilir.

Page 12: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Ürün Release olmadığından Trial versiyon indirdiğimiz için Evaluation seçimini yaparak “Next” diyelim.

Page 13: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Lisans anlaşmasını kabul edelim ve “Next” diyelim.

Page 14: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Use Microsoft Update to check forupdates (recommended) seçeneğini seçerek kurulum öncesi gerekli güncellemeleri alalım.

Page 15: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Use Microsoft Update to check forupdates (recommended) seçeneğini seçerek kurulum öncesi gerekli güncellemeleri alalım.

Page 16: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Kurulum öncesi sistem gereksinimLeri kontrol edilir. Gerekli bileşenler var İSE sadece Windows Firewall uyarı verir. Bu hata değildir. “Next” ile ilerliyoruz.

Page 17: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Bu ekranda tüm Sql özelliklerini kurabilir veya sadece gerekli olan bileşenler kurulabilir. “Next” diyelim.

Page 18: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Page 19: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Rollerin bir listesinde gerekli olan rolleri kurabileceğiniz gibi bir önceki ekranda bize diğer seçenek olarak sunulan tüm rollerin kurulması işlemini de yapılabilir.

Database Engine Services ve ManagementTools seçeneklerini seçip “Next” ile ilerleyelim.

Page 20: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Page 21: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Bu ekranda Sql server kurulduğunda hangi Instanceismi ile kurulacak ise bizden onun bilgisi istenmektedir.

Özel bir isim kullanmayacağız için default instanceismi olan “MSSQLSERVER” ismini olduğu gibi bırakalım.

Kurulum yeri olarak Default dizine kurulmasını istediğimden değişiklik yapmıyorum. Bu adımı da geçerek “Next” diyelim.

Page 22: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Intance Name

Diğer Intance Name bu platformda varsa

Liste boş başka intance yok.

Page 23: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Server Configuration ekranında Service Accounts tabında SQL Server 2016 Servislerini çalıştıracak kullanıcı hesapları belirlenir.

Şimdilik olduğu gibi bırakıyoruz.

Page 24: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Collation tabından SQL Server dil ve karakter set ayarları yapılır.

Page 25: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Database Engine Configuration kısmında kimlik doğrulama metodunu seçmemiz ve

Page 26: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Kimlik doğrulama metodunu için kullanıcı belirlememiz istenmektedir.

Eklemek Silmek

Page 27: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

“Windows authencation mode” seçimini yapacağız.

Bu metot ile kimlik doğrulaması yaptığım için Windows kullanıcılarından bir tanesini seçmem gerekmekte.

Kurulumu TEST hesabı ile yaptığımız için “AddCurrnet User” seçimini yaparak TEST kullanıcısının otomatik eklenmesini sağlayabiliriz. TEST hesabımız eklendi.

Page 28: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

TEST hesabımız eklendi.

Page 29: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Data Directories tabında log, db ve bileşenlerin kurulacağı yerler belirlenmektedir.

Page 30: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Artık kurulumu başlatabiliriz. Bilgisayarınızın performansına ve seçilen bileşenlere göre değişken bir zaman alacaktır.

Page 31: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Kurulum başarı ile tamamlandı. Bize bir sonuç yansıtılmaktadır. “Close” ile kurulum sona erer.

Page 32: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Sql Server 2016 CTP2.1 Management Studio’yuaçarak kurulum durumuna bakalım.

Page 33: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Ekranda gelen bilgiler ile “login” olalım.

Page 34: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Sorunsuz şekilde Sql serverimize bağlandığımızda databaseleri görebilir ve işlemler yapabiliriz.

Page 35: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

MsSQL 2016 Beta Kurulumu

SQL

SER

VER

INST

ALL

ATIO

N C

ENTE

R

Programımızın versiyon bilgisi aşağıdaki gibi. HelpHakkında..

Page 36: Ders Tanıtım Sunumu Database Managegement II · Sql server kurulduğunda hangi Instance R ismi ile kurulacak ise bizden onun bilgisi istenmektedir. Özel bir isim kullanmayacağız

Devamı Haftaya…